# REST API Authentication
|
||||
|
||||
The NetBox API employs token-based authentication. For convenience, cookie authentication can also be used when navigating the browsable API.

## Tokens
|
||||
|
||||
A token is a unique identifier that identifies a user to the API. Each user in NetBox may have one or more tokens which he or she can use to authenticate to the API. To create a token, navigate to the API tokens page at `/user/api-tokens/`.

Additionally, a token can be set to expire at a specific time. This can be useful if an external client needs to be granted temporary access to NetBox.

## Authenticating to the API
|
||||
|
||||
By default, read operations will be available without authentication. In this case, a token may be included in the request, but is not necessary.
